It was discovered on 19 September 1973, by Dutch astronomer couple Ingrid and Cornelis van Houten on photographic plates taken by Dutch–American astronomer Tom Gehrels at the Palomar Observatory in California.[1] The first precovery was taken at the discovering observatory in 1951, extending the asteroid's observation arc by 22 years prior to its discovery.[1]
As an anomaly, the asteroid did not receive a typical survey designation, although it was discovered in 1973, when the discovering trio of astronomers were conducting their second Palomar–Leiden Trojan survey (T-2).
According to the survey carried out by the NEOWISE mission of NASA's space-based Wide-field Infrared Survey Explorer, the asteroid measures 41.09 kilometers in diameter, and its surface has an albedo of 0.060,[6] while the Collaborative Asteroid Lightcurve Link assumes a standard albedo for carbonaceous bodies of 0.057 and calculates a diameter of 42.23 kilometers with an absolute magnitude of 10.6.[8]
